Specific gravity is a measure of a material's density (mass per unit volume) as compared to the density of water at 73.4°F (23°C). Aggregate is classified as two different types, coarse and fine. Coarse aggregate is usually greater than 4.75 mm (retained on a No. 4 sieve), while fine aggregate is less than 4.75 mm (passing the No. 4 sieve). ... This is achieved by using OD aggregate. Bulk Density: Mass of a unit volume of bulk aggregate material, in which the volume includes the volume of the individual particles and the volume of the voids between the particles. Expressed in kg/m 3 (lb/ft 3). Unit Weight: Mass per unit volume of aggregates or density. Voids: The space between particles in an aggregate mass not occupied by solid …

Coarse aggregate is a term used to describe the larger-sized particles that form the bulk of concrete mixes. These particles are typically greater than 4.75 mm (0.187 inches) in diameter. Coarse aggregates are obtained from natural sources, such as quarries, or can be manufactured by crushing rocks or recycling concrete waste. ... and density ...

Aggregate is usually described as either coarse aggregate (retained 4.75 mm) or fine aggregate (passing 4.75 mm). Aggregates generally make up about 95 percent of the total mass of hot-mix asphalt mixtures and 80 percent by mass of concrete - aggregate properties are, therefore, critical for quality hot-mix asphalt or concrete.
